I have had this issue with other drives. Have you tried locating the drive on control panel>hardware and sound>devices and printers? If it is visible here, look below:
Sometimes on windows computers, the drive is not visible because the name of it changed or sometimes its even the thumb drive input changed from the last time you used the same drive in the computer so it won't see it correctly. I don't know why this is the case but it is. When you format a drive on the bmpcc4k, then name will change every time you reformat. If you go in the file path I showed above, right click the device (if visible) and troubleshoot, then disconnect/reconnect the drive, it should work. You might need to uninstall the thumb driver and reinstall on connecting the drive. I have had to do this a few times with drives connecting via docking station or hubs.
Whatever you do, don't reformat if something important is on the drive. I read a thread where somebody reformatted the drive thinking that would fix the issue and I am pretty sure you know how that ended.
